Average Rent Trends in Bellflower, CA
Rent in Bellflower, CA varies by number of bedrooms and home type. Use these charts to quickly see how rent changes.
Average rent decreased in May 2026 compared to the previous month. Rent previously peaked in Sep 2025.
| Month | Average rent |
|---|---|
| Jun 2025 | $2,200 |
| Jul 2025 | $2,250 |
| Aug 2025 | $2,259 |
| Sep 2025 | $2,295 |
| Oct 2025 | $2,225 |
| Nov 2025 | $2,200 |
| Dec 2025 | $2,200 |
| Jan 2026 | $2,200 |
| Feb 2026 | $2,250 |
| Mar 2026 | $2,250 |
| Apr 2026 | $2,269 |
| May 2026 | $2,195 |
Average Rent By Bedroom and Home Type
In May 2026, Apartments and Condos were the most affordable home type to rent compared with Houses and Townhomes.
| 1 bed | 2 beds | 3 beds | 4 beds | All |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| All home types | $1,950 | $2,300 | $3,500 | $3,950 | $2,250 |
| Townhomes | — | $2,500 | $3,595 | — | $3,800 |
| Apartments and Condos | $1,811 | $2,299 | $3,200 | $3,950 | $2,000 |
| Houses | $2,150 | $2,950 | $3,650 | $4,500 | $3,295 |
Frequently Asked Questions about Rentals in Bellflower, CA
- What is the average rent of an apartment in Bellflower, CA?The average rent of an apartment in Bellflower, CA is $2,185 per month. This is about 13% higher than the national average.
- What is the average rent of a house in Bellflower, CA?The average rent of a house in Bellflower, CA is $3,295 per month. This is about 71% higher than the national average.
- What is the average rent of a townhome in Bellflower, CA?The average rent of a townhome in Bellflower, CA is $3,350 per month. This is about 74% higher than the national average.
- When is the average rent cheapest in Bellflower, CA?In the last year, the average rent in Bellflower, CA was lowest in May 2025 when it was $2,145 per month.
- When is the average rent most expensive in Bellflower, CA?In the last year, the average rent in Bellflower, CA was highest in Sep 2025 when it was $2,295 per month.
- How does the rent of a 1 bedroom apartment compare to a studio apartment in Bellflower, CA?The average rent of a 1 bedroom apartment in Bellflower, CA is $1,950 per month. That is about $355 more than the cost of a studio apartment.
